Curator's Notes With its large number of hot springs and public baths, Japan is serious about its bathing rituals. Adding salts and essential oils creates a soothing bath, and taking the time to stir the mixture helps release its full aroma that permeates the bathroom's atmosphere. We love the design of this hinoki bath stirrer, which has holes in the paddle to easily stir and circulate water. Consisting of all wood joinery, this stirrer is made from hinoki cypress, which is renowned for its warm scent and mold-and-mildew resistant properties.
